Twitter Bootstrap Web Development

Twitter Bootstrap Web Development pdf epub mobi txt 电子书 下载 2026

出版者:Packt Publishing
作者:David Cochran
出品人:
页数:68
译者:
出版时间:2012-11-12
价格:USD 19.99
装帧:Paperback
isbn号码:9781849518826
丛书系列:
图书标签:
  • Bootstrap
  • WebDevelopment
  • Web
  • 软件开发
  • Web开发
  • Twitter
  • 计算机
  • 前端
  • Bootstrap
  • 前端开发
  • Web开发
  • HTML
  • CSS
  • JavaScript
  • 响应式设计
  • 前端框架
  • UI设计
  • 网页设计
想要找书就要到 图书目录大全
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

《响应式 Web 架构:掌握前端开发新范式》 本书并非关于某个特定前端框架的详尽操作手册,而是深入探讨构建现代、响应式、高性能 Web 应用的底层架构与核心理念。我们将抛开框架的语法细节,聚焦于那些支撑起优雅用户体验和 robust 应用程序的基石。 第一部分:响应式设计与移动优先策略 在当今多设备交织的数字时代,响应式设计不再是可选项,而是必选项。本部分将带您从根源上理解响应式设计为何如此重要,并深入剖析其背后的设计哲学。我们将系统学习如何规划和实现“移动优先”的开发流程,确保您的 Web 应用在最小的屏幕上也能提供流畅、直观的体验,并在此基础上优雅地扩展到桌面端。 核心概念: 像素密度、视口、断点、流式布局、弹性盒子(Flexbox)与网格系统(CSS Grid)的原理与应用。 实践技巧: 如何进行有效的断点设计,针对不同设备优化图片和媒体资源,实现触摸友好型交互。 设计思维: 从用户体验出发,构建跨越设备界限的无缝浏览旅程。 第二部分:Web 性能优化与用户体验 一个快速响应的 Web 应用是留住用户的关键。本部分将揭示 Web 性能的瓶颈所在,并提供一套系统性的优化策略,涵盖前端的方方面面。您将学会如何测量、分析和改进加载速度、渲染效率以及用户交互的响应能力。 性能指标: 理解关键渲染路径、First Contentful Paint (FCP)、Largest Contentful Paint (LCP)、Time To Interactive (TTI) 等核心性能指标。 资源优化: 精准控制 CSS 和 JavaScript 的加载与执行,实现代码分割(Code Splitting)和按需加载,优化图片和字体资源。 渲染技术: 深入理解浏览器渲染流程,掌握如何减少重绘(Repaint)和回流(Reflow),优化动画性能。 缓存策略: 有效利用浏览器缓存和服务器端缓存,加速后续页面访问。 第三部分:现代前端架构模式 随着 Web 应用的复杂度不断提升,良好的架构设计变得至关重要。本部分将为您梳理并剖析几种主流的前端架构模式,帮助您理解如何在不同的项目场景下选择和应用最适合的架构。我们将讨论如何组织代码、管理状态、处理异步操作以及构建可维护、可扩展的前端系统。 模块化与组件化: 从文件结构到逻辑划分,深入理解模块化和组件化的强大之处,以及如何构建高内聚、低耦合的组件。 状态管理: 探讨不同层级的状态管理需求,从简单的本地状态到复杂的全局状态,理解其管理挑战与解决方案。 异步编程: 掌握 Promises、async/await 等现代 JavaScript 异步编程范式,优雅地处理网络请求和耗时操作。 设计模式的应用: 结合实际开发场景,讲解如单例模式、观察者模式、发布/订阅模式等在前端中的应用。 第四部分:构建工具与自动化流程 高效的构建工具是现代前端开发的加速器。本部分将聚焦于当前主流的构建工具和自动化流程,帮助您理解它们的工作原理,并掌握如何配置和优化它们,以提升开发效率和部署质量。 模块打包器(Bundlers): 深入理解 Webpack、Vite 等打包工具的核心概念,如模块解析、loader、plugin、tree-shaking。 代码转换与转译(Transpilation): 理解 Babel 等工具如何将现代 JavaScript 语法转换为浏览器兼容的代码。 自动化测试: 介绍单元测试、集成测试、端到端测试的重要性,以及如何将其集成到构建流程中。 CI/CD 基础: 触及持续集成与持续部署(CI/CD)的基本概念,了解如何自动化构建、测试和部署流程。 第五部分:可访问性(Accessibility)与安全性基础 构建包容性 Web 应用是每一个开发者应有的责任。本部分将引导您关注 Web 可访问性,确保所有用户,无论其能力如何,都能顺畅地使用您的 Web 应用。同时,我们也将触及 Web 应用开发中的基础安全原则,帮助您构建更稳健的系统。 Web 标准与 WCAG: 理解 Web 内容可访问性指南(WCAG)的核心原则。 语义化 HTML: 学习如何利用 HTML 的语义化结构提升可访问性。 ARIA 属性: 掌握 ARIA(Accessible Rich Internet Applications)属性的应用,增强动态内容的辅助技术支持。 基础安全防护: 了解常见的 Web 安全威胁,如 XSS(跨站脚本攻击)、CSRF(跨站请求伪造),并学习基础的防御措施。 目标读者: 本书适合有一定 Web 开发基础,希望深入理解前端架构、性能优化、构建流程以及提升应用质量和用户体验的开发者。无论您是初级开发者寻求进阶,还是资深开发者渴望巩固和拓展知识体系,本书都将为您提供宝贵的洞见和实用的指导。 通过对这些核心理念和实践的深入学习,您将能够更自信地应对复杂的前端项目,构建出既美观又强大,兼顾性能与用户体验的下一代 Web 应用。

作者简介

目录信息

读后感

评分

失败的教材。 1.企图覆盖完全小白读者群,浪费了不少文字在非常琐碎的地方。 2.列一段代码,然后讲每一部分是干什么,这是程序书的经典套路。但是作者标新立异的用了一直指令式的教学方法,使有用的信息分布非常零散。

评分

一本很棒的Bootstrap入门书,通过几个简单的例子,便勾起我的兴趣。虽然页数不多,但足以显示Bootsrap之强大,也足以将对Bootstrap好奇的人引入Bootstrap学习的道路,犹如一道美味的小甜点。  

评分

失败的教材。 1.企图覆盖完全小白读者群,浪费了不少文字在非常琐碎的地方。 2.列一段代码,然后讲每一部分是干什么,这是程序书的经典套路。但是作者标新立异的用了一直指令式的教学方法,使有用的信息分布非常零散。

评分

失败的教材。 1.企图覆盖完全小白读者群,浪费了不少文字在非常琐碎的地方。 2.列一段代码,然后讲每一部分是干什么,这是程序书的经典套路。但是作者标新立异的用了一直指令式的教学方法,使有用的信息分布非常零散。

评分

失败的教材。 1.企图覆盖完全小白读者群,浪费了不少文字在非常琐碎的地方。 2.列一段代码,然后讲每一部分是干什么,这是程序书的经典套路。但是作者标新立异的用了一直指令式的教学方法,使有用的信息分布非常零散。

用户评价

评分

老实说,我之前对前端框架有些敬而远之,觉得它们过于复杂,学习曲线陡峭。但《Twitter Bootstrap Web Development》彻底改变了我的看法。这本书的结构安排非常有条理,每一章节都像是在解开一个谜题,让我一步步地掌握Bootstrap的核心概念。书中对于排版(Typography)和表单(Forms)的讲解尤其让我印象深刻。作者详细介绍了Bootstrap如何利用预设的样式类来快速实现美观且响应式的文本排版,以及如何通过简单的class组合来构建功能强大的表单。我过去总是花费大量时间在这些基础的样式上,现在有了Bootstrap,我可以在几分钟内完成,然后将更多精力放在页面的交互和内容上。书中还介绍了如何利用Bootstrap的Utility Classes来实现各种细小的样式调整,这就像给我的前端开发工具箱增加了一堆趁手的工具,让我在细节上也能游刃有余。而且,作者在讲解过程中,并没有回避一些可能遇到的坑,并且提供了相应的解决方案,这让我避免了很多不必要的弯路。这本书的实用性非常强,让我能够快速地将Bootstrap应用到实际项目中,并看到立竿见影的效果。

评分

我一直对精美的网页设计充满好奇,但苦于没有系统的指导,只能零散地学习一些零碎的知识。直到我翻开了《Twitter Bootstrap Web Development》,才找到了真正的“敲门砖”。这本书的语言风格非常平实,没有过多的技术术语堆砌,让我这个非计算机专业背景的读者也能轻松理解。作者在讲解过程中,非常注重理论与实践的结合,每一个知识点都会配上详细的代码示例,并且还会解释这些代码背后的原理。我印象最深刻的是关于组件(Components)的讲解,比如导航栏(Navbar)、卡片(Cards)、模态框(Modals)等等,书中都一一列举了它们的用法和定制方法,并且提供了很多实际的应用场景。这让我能够很快地将学到的知识应用到自己的项目中,设计出更具吸引力的网页。这本书还特别强调了“一致性”和“可维护性”的重要性,在讲解Bootstrap的class命名规范和设计原则时,让我受益匪浅。我现在写出来的代码不仅美观,而且更易于他人理解和维护,这对于团队协作来说非常重要。总而言之,这本书不仅仅是一本技术手册,更像是一位经验丰富的老师,循循善诱地引导我走向前端开发的乐趣。

评分

这本《Twitter Bootstrap Web Development》就像一本为我量身打造的指南,让我这个刚入行的新手也能轻松驾驭前端开发。书中的讲解逻辑非常清晰,从最基础的HTML和CSS入手,循序渐进地引入Bootstrap的各种组件和布局。特别是对于响应式设计的概念,作者用了很多生动的例子,让我不再为不同屏幕尺寸的适配问题而烦恼。我尤其喜欢书中关于网格系统(Grid System)的章节,它把复杂的响应式布局变得简单易懂,只需要拖拽和调整几个数字,就能实现完美的页面结构。而且,书中提供的很多代码示例都非常实用,可以直接拿来套用,大大节省了我的开发时间。作者还贴心地介绍了Bootstrap的一些高级技巧,比如如何自定义主题、如何利用JavaScript插件来增强用户体验等等,这些都让我眼前一亮,感觉学到了很多实用的干货。总的来说,这本书的内容非常丰富,覆盖了Bootstrap开发中的各个方面,从入门到进阶,都能够得到很好的指导。对于想要快速掌握Bootstrap,并能独立完成响应式网页开发的读者来说,这本书绝对是不可多得的学习资料。它不仅教会了我“怎么做”,更让我理解了“为什么这么做”,这对于建立扎实的前端开发基础至关重要。

评分

这本书《Twitter Bootstrap Web Development》给我最大的感觉就是“化繁为简”。它就像一股清流,将复杂的前端开发过程变得更加直观和易于管理。作者在书中并没有仅仅停留在讲解Bootstrap的组件和用法,而是更注重培养读者的“设计思维”。通过大量的案例分析,我学会了如何利用Bootstrap的布局系统来构建具有良好用户体验的界面,如何巧妙地运用其预设的样式类来快速实现各种设计效果,以及如何通过简单的调整来满足不同设备上的显示需求。书中对于“可访问性”(Accessibility)的讲解也让我印象深刻,它提醒我们在追求美观的同时,也不能忽视用户的多样性,如何利用Bootstrap的语义化标签和ARIA属性来提升网页的可访问性。而且,这本书的排版和设计也非常精美,阅读体验极佳,让我能够沉浸在学习的乐趣中。即使我之前对前端开发了解不多,也能通过这本书快速上手,并且能够独立完成很多具有吸引力的网页项目。它不仅仅是一本技术书籍,更是一本激发我创造力的指南。

评分

作为一名已经从事前端开发一段时间的开发者,我一直在寻找能够提升工作效率和代码质量的工具。无意中发现了《Twitter Bootstrap Web Development》,这本书简直是我近期最大的惊喜。作者在书中深入浅出地讲解了Bootstrap的最新版本特性,包括Flexbox的集成、自定义组件的创建以及与JavaScript框架的结合方式。书中提供的很多高级技巧,例如如何创建自定义的Bootstrap主题,如何优化Bootstrap的性能,以及如何利用Bootstrap的组件来构建复杂的单页应用,都让我耳目一新。我特别欣赏书中关于“可扩展性”的讲解,作者详细介绍了如何通过 Sass/Less 来修改Bootstrap的变量和覆盖其样式,这使得我们可以根据项目需求来定制一套独一无二的Bootstrap风格。而且,书中还分享了一些关于Bootstrap项目管理的最佳实践,例如如何组织文件结构、如何进行版本控制等等,这些都为我构建更健壮、更易维护的前端项目提供了宝贵的经验。总的来说,这本书的内容非常前沿,而且讲解深入,让我能够从更高层面去理解和运用Bootstrap。

评分

不如官方文档

评分

断断续续一天的时间看完了 说实话 还不如看手册...

评分

断断续续一天的时间看完了 说实话 还不如看手册...

评分

入门

评分

Bootstrap入门

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.wenda123.org All Rights Reserved. 图书目录大全 版权所有